In this video, we walk through the fundamentals of building a PBX server using Asterisk, the open-source telephony platform that powers thousands of VoIP systems around the world.

You’ll learn the key concepts behind how an Asterisk server works, the main components that make up a PBX system, and how to install Asterisk on a Linux machine from the ground up. Whether you're building a VoIP lab, hosting PBX systems for clients, or learning the foundations of telephony infrastructure, this video will give you a practical starting point.

Topics covered include:

What Asterisk is and how it functions as a PBX

The core components of an Asterisk-based system

Preparing a Linux server for installation

Installing and configuring Asterisk

Understanding the architecture behind VoIP systems
